About Mission Produce
Mission Produce, Inc. engages in the sourcing, farming, packaging, marketing, and distribution of avocados, mangoes, and blueberries to food retailers, wholesalers, and foodservice customers in the United States and internationally. The company operates through three segments, Marketing and Distribution; International Farming; and Blueberries. It also provides ripening, bagging, custom packing, logistical management, and quality assurance services. Financial Performance
In fiscal year 2025, Mission Produce's revenue was $1.39 billion, an increase of 12.68% compared to the previous year's $1.23 billion. Earnings were $37.70 million, an increase of 2.72%.

Mission Produce Earnings Call Transcript: Q1 2026
Q1 saw strong avocado volume growth and margin expansion despite a 17% revenue decline from lower pricing. The pending Calavo acquisition is on track, expected to deliver significant synergies and expand product offerings. Q2 guidance anticipates margin compression and lower EBITDA due to continued pricing pressure.

Mission Produce Transcript: M&A announcement
A definitive agreement was reached to acquire Calavo in a cash and stock deal, creating a diversified, vertically integrated produce leader with expanded scale, $25M in expected cost synergies, and significant growth opportunities in prepared foods and global markets.
